The Mount Barker District Council is located between 20 and 45 kilometres south-east of Adelaide. The District is bounded by the Adelaide Hills and Mid-Murray Council areas in the north, the Rural City of Murray Bridge in the east, the Alexandrina Council in the south and the City of Onkaparinga in the west.

The area is characterised by rural and rural-residential with rapidly growing urban areas. Key economic indicators for the region include:

  • Gross Regional Product: $1.21 billion
  • Population: 31,950
  • Local jobs: 10,882
  • Largest industry sector: Retail
  • Number of local businesses: 2,664
  • Employed residents: 16,803

(Source: Economy i.d.)
